I have a 98 GST 7 bolt engine I’m rebuilding and I was wondering if I can reuse my crank main bearing cap bolts, I’ve heard different things about reusing them and just wanted to get my own answers. Thanks
 
The factory service manual doesn’t note these as “never re-use”, as it would for, say, o-rings or cotter pins. I would re-use them if it were the first rebuild on a stock motor that will remain stock in terms of power level, and if there were no serious issues with the old main bearings. If it was the second rebuild, or power was or will be increased much above factory, then I would not risk it. Plenty of folks go with ARP bolts or studs for high-power builds as standard.
 
Check the under head length. The original length of 7 bolt main bolt is 70.0mm, the limit is 71.1mm. Do not reuse if it is exceeded the limit or if it is close to the limit.. You can reuse it if the UHL is within the limit, but anyways it's cheap, so replacing would be also a good idea even if it's still within the limit or if you are unsure.
